Influence of micro-heterogeneity of fractured-porous reservoirs on the water flooding mobilization law

The storage space of fractured-porous reservoirs includes a variety of primary pores, secondary pores and fractures and has strong micro-heterogeneity. When water injection is used for development, the development effects of different development areas are significantly different. In order to clarify the influence of micro-heterogeneity on the water flooding mobilization law, three types of glass etching models were designed according to actual oilfield. Water flooding experimental research was conducted on the models. The results show that the mobilization mode changes from a uniform mobilization mode to a network mobilization mode as the heterogeneity of the pore system increases. The recovery degree of pore throat structure I model is 31.8% lower than that of pore throat structure II model. The fracture system of fractured-porous reservoirs is shown as a finger-like mobilization mode along with the fractures. This model has a 19.8% lower recovery degree than pore throat structure II model but 12% higher than pore throat structure I model. The water flooding law was studied from the utilization order of large and small pore throats, and the shape of water flooding front was compared and analyzed, which provides a guiding significance for the enhanced oil recovery of fractured-porous reservoirs.
